> > Hi all. I am brand new to monodevelop and would like to get some
> > experience with C# and .net via mono. I've seen there are nice project
> > templates for Gtk# project, but can't see one based on winforms. I mean,
> > if I choose a Gtk# project, I get a predefinded application with gui
> > interface, while selecting C# blank project, does not contain any gui
> > interface. Did I miss something or do I have to desing winforms based
> > project from scratch? Thanks for your help.
> >
>
> I don't think there any any predefined templates for Win-forms application
> cuase there is no GUI-designer for Win-forms (yet?), but nothing stops you
> from creating a blank solution and work with the System.Windows.Forms
> namespace.


Wouldn't it be trivial to add a Winforms template project, with a main form,
menu, and maybe an About dialogue? I don't understand what the the lack of a
GUI-designer for Winforms has to do with the lack of a starting point.
(Perhaps this being used as a way to "encourage" people to use GTK... but
some of us need to use Winforms on Mono, so it is just annoying.)

Isn't there a way to create a Winforms project in VS and then migrate it to
Mono?
